Introduction

This case highlights how Salesforce and Certinia PSA administration capabilities were used to improve operational efficiency, financial governance, and reporting accuracy in complex enterprise environments. The focus is on time tracking, resource management, compliance alignment, and scalable administrative practices.

Context

The Salesforce landscape supported professional services operations with integrated time tracking, billing, resource planning, and financial reporting. Certinia PSA functioned as a core system for managing project delivery and utilization, while Salesforce provided the security model, automation framework, and reporting layer. The environment required close alignment between operational teams, finance stakeholders, and compliance functions, particularly in audit-sensitive contexts.

Challenge

The primary challenge involved improving the reliability and timeliness of timesheet submissions while maintaining strict access control and audit readiness. Delays in approvals affected billing cycles and forecasting accuracy, while inconsistent data quality reduced confidence in utilization and margin reporting. At the same time, the platform needed to meet internal control and regulatory expectations, including traceability of changes, segregation of duties, and secure handling of sensitive data.

Approach

The approach emphasized declarative automation, governance-first security design, and continuous data quality monitoring. Salesforce and Certinia configurations were reviewed holistically to identify friction points in timesheet workflows and approval hierarchies. Automated reminders and escalation logic were introduced to reduce manual follow-ups and enforce accountability. Validation rules and periodic audits were used to improve the accuracy of resource and project data. Reporting and dashboards were designed to surface real-time operational and financial insights, enabling faster decision-making without manual data manipulation.

Solution

Timesheet workflows within Certinia PSA were enhanced with automated alerts, escalation protocols, and clearly defined approval paths aligned to project and departmental structures. User access was administered through carefully managed roles, permission sets, and sharing rules to ensure both data security and appropriate visibility. Salesforce audit features such as field history tracking and audit trails were enabled and monitored to support compliance requirements. Dashboards and reports were developed to provide visibility into utilization, billing health, margin performance, and approval bottlenecks. Administrative operations were supported through structured incident management, controlled deployments, and disciplined data operations to maintain platform stability.

Outcome

The improved system reduced approval delays, increased confidence in project and financial reporting, and strengthened compliance posture. Operational teams benefited from clearer workflows and timely reminders, while finance and leadership gained access to accurate, real-time insights. From an administrative perspective, the platform became easier to govern, audit, and scale as business needs evolved.
